29 CFR  1910.178(l)(1)(i): The employer did not ensure that each powered industrial truck operator is competent to operate a powered industrial truck safely, as demonstrated by the successful completion of the training and evaluation specified in this paragraph (l):  (a) On or about December 21, 2021 the employer did not ensure that each powered industrial truck operator was competent to operate a powered industrial truck as required through successful completion of training and evaluation.

29 CFR  1910.1200(h)(1): Employees were not provided effective information and training on hazardous chemicals in their work area at the time of their initial assignment and whenever a new hazard that the employees had not been previously trained about was introduced into their work area:  (a) On or about December 21, 2021, the employer did not ensure that employees were provided effective information and training on the chemicals in their work area, including but not limited to, Goof Off Gunk and Adhesive Remover.
